The Canyon Country Advisory Committee (CCAC), a division of the Santa Clarita City Council will hold its regular meeting Wednesday, Sept. 20, 2017 from 7 p.m. to 9 p.m.
The meeting will be held at the Mint Canyon Moose Family Center Banquet Room located at 18000 Sierra Highway, Canyon Country 91351 (on Sierra Highway less than a mile north of Soledad Canyon Road).
CCAC meetings are open to the public and free of charge.
This month’s agenda will include:
– COC 20th Anniversary in Canyon Country:
Presented by: Edel Alonso & Joan MacGregor, COC Board of Trustees
– Ugly Solar Panels in Canyon View Estates
What can the city do about it?
Presented By: Alan Ferdman, CCAC Chair
– Santa Clarita Fallen Warriors Memorial
Finally Approved and Construction Timeline
Presented by: Bill Reynolds, Veterans Advocate
– Santa Clarita Crime Statistics are going up?
What our city council intends to do about it.
Presented by: Alan Ferdman, CCAC Chair
– The Gazette Today
Presented by: Doug Sutton, Owner & Publisher
Plus, much more.
Adequate parking will be available at the Moose Lodge for CCAC Meeting Attendees.
Should the entrance to the Moose Lodge parking lot on Sierra Highway be blocked, the side parking lot entrance will be open.
